Overview

Translation services have become a vital component of global communication, facilitating the exchange of ideas and information across linguistic and cultural boundaries. With the rise of the internet, the demand for translation services has increased, driven by the need for businesses, governments, and individuals to connect with diverse audiences worldwide. The translation process involves the conversion of written or spoken content from one language to another, requiring a deep understanding of linguistic nuances, cultural context, and technical expertise. According to some sources, companies like Google and Microsoft are investing heavily in machine learning and artificial intelligence to improve translation accuracy and efficiency.

🎯 Introduction to Translation Services

Introduction to Translation Services — Translation services have been around for centuries, with early examples including the translation of ancient texts like the Rosetta Stone. However, with the advent of the internet and globalization, the demand for translation services has increased. Companies like Lionbridge and TransPerfect have emerged as major players in the industry, offering a range of services from document translation to interpretation and localization.

🌍 Cultural Impact and Significance

Cultural Impact and Significance — Translation services have a profound impact on cultural exchange and understanding, enabling people to communicate across linguistic and cultural boundaries. The translation of literary works, for example, has played a significant role in shaping cultural identity and promoting cross-cultural understanding. Authors like Jorge Luis Borges and Gabriel Garcia Marquez have been widely translated and have had a significant impact on world literature.

🤔 Controversies and Challenges

Controversies and Challenges — Despite the many advances in translation technology, there are still several challenges and controversies surrounding translation services. One of the main challenges is ensuring the accuracy and quality of machine-generated translations, which can sometimes lack the nuance and context of human translation. Additionally, there are concerns about the impact of automation on the translation industry, with some translators fearing that machines will replace human translators.

What is the difference between translation and interpretation?

Translation refers to the written rendering of a text from one language to another, while interpretation refers to the oral or signed rendering of speech between languages. According to United Nations guidelines, interpreters must have a deep understanding of the source and target languages, as well as the cultural context of the communication.
